The Ideal Shower Temperature for Skin and Hair
While hot showers may feel relaxing, they can strip the skin of essential oils and leave hair dry or brittle.
Warm water is the ideal balance. It allows you to:
- Cleanse effectively without over-drying
- Maintain natural skin hydration
- Protect the scalp
- Support healthy hair texture
For an added benefit, finishing with slightly cooler water can help refresh the skin and scalp.

The 5 Step Men’s Shower Routine for Busy Mornings
1. Start with warm water
Begin with warm water to loosen dirt, oil, and sweat, allowing cleansers to work effectively.
2. Cleanse your hair and scalp
Apply the product to the scalp and massage gently.
- Remove sweat and excess oil
- Stimulate circulation
- Avoid aggressive scrubbing
3. Cleanse your face and body
Use a formulation designed to cleanse without disrupting the skin barrier.
4. Rinse thoroughly
Ensure no residue remains on the skin or scalp, as leftover product can cause dryness or irritation.
5. Optional shaving and final rinse
Shave at the end of your shower when hair is softened and skin is hydrated, then rinse clean.

Common Shower Routine Mistakes Men Make
- Using water that is too hot, leading to dryness and irritation
- Using harsh body wash on the face - causing sensitivity
- Overwashing hair - disrupting scalp balance
- Using too many products - reducing consistency
What to Do After Your Shower
A few simple steps after your shower help maintain results:
- Pat skin dry with a clean towel
- Apply deodorant
- Use moisturiser if needed
- Style hair as required
Can You Use Body Wash on Your Face?
Many standard body washes are too harsh for facial skin, which is thinner and more sensitive.
However, well-developed formulations can be designed to work across face, hair, and body - provided they maintain a balance between cleansing and skin barrier protection.
